MSc Cyber Security – USe

Course Overview

The MSc Cyber Security develops advanced knowledge of protecting digital systems, networks, and information assets from cyber threats. Students study ethical hacking, security management, cryptography, digital forensics, and risk assessment.

Graduates are prepared for careers in cybersecurity operations, information security, penetration testing, security consulting, and cyber defence.

Entry Requirements

  • Academic Records: Recognized b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Cyber Security, Software Engineering, or a related discipline.
  • English Proficiency: IELTS 6.5, TOEFL iBT 88, PTE Academic 61, or equivalent.
  • Academic Background: Knowledge of networking, operating systems, and information security is preferred.
  • Application Materials: Bachelor’s transcripts, CV/resume, personal statement, academic reference(s), and passport copy.
  • Additional Requirements: Networking or cyber security experience is beneficial but not compulsory.
